The Naperville School System
Naperville is a diverse community of more than 145,000 residents and is home to one of the state’s most elite public school districts. Naperville Community Unit School District No. 203 serves nearly 17,000 students in its 21 schools.

Naperville Test Scores
Naperville students will face state exams throughout their years in school. They take the Partnership for Assessment of Readiness for College and Careers (PARCC) beginning in third grade. The PARCC assesses their performance in English language arts and mathematics. In addition, they’ll take the Illinois Science Assessment in grades 5 and 8, and again as a high school biology student. College-bound students or those looking to attend private schools take various admissions exams, such as the ISEE, SAT, and ACT. Naperville High School Rankings
High School | Naperville Ranking | State Ranking | AP Pass Rate |
---|---|---|---|
Naperville Central High School | 1 | 15 | 92% |
Neuqua Valley High School | 2 | 17 | 76% |
Naperville North High School | 3 | 19 | 93% |
Metea Valley High School | 4 | 22 | 80% |
Waubonsie Valley High School | 5 | 28 | 70% |
One advantage of the schools in Naperville is that the classroom sizes are reasonable. Even the largest schools have small class sizes, with around 16 students per teacher. That’s in line with the average for the state. You can see a breakdown of student-teacher ratios at select area high schools below.
Naperville Student-to-Teacher Ratios
Neuqua Valley High School has a 17 1 student-teacher ratio.
Bolingbrook High School has a 15 1 student-teacher ratio.
Naperville Central High School has a 16 1 student-teacher ratio.
Metea Valley High School has a 17 1 student-teacher ratio.
Naperville North High School has a 15 1 student-teacher ratio.
Illinois State Average has a 15 1 student-teacher ratio.
